Andy Warhol talks about love, sex, food, beauty, fame, work, money, success, about New York and America, about himself, good times and bad, the explosion of his career in the 1960s and life among celebrities.

Andy Warhol
Andy Warhol was an iconic American artist known for his pop art style, including his famous piece "Campbell's Soup Cans." His work revolutionized the art world by blurring the lines between high and low culture. Warhol's unique approach to art and his fascination with consumer culture continue to influence artists today.
